Below are the results from our initial ThoughtExchange that we gathered at the beginning of the night. The ThoughtExchange is still "live" and you can join and share your thoughts using the QR Code or by logging in online. The Thought Exchange will close at Noon on Friday.
The responses emphasize the importance of community involvement and consideration of student needs in the decision-making process for Navasota ISD and the Grimes County future. They highlight the need for strategic planning to accommodate growth, efficient use of tax dollars, and the importance of building facilities to cater to the increasing student capacity. The responses also stress the need for immediate action due to the time and cost implications of building. Furthermore, they underscore the necessity of considering the impact on all students, particularly the economically disadvantaged, and ensuring their voices are heard.
